Whiskey: Hazelburn 13 Year Old Sherry Wood Campbeltown Single Malt Scotch
This release of Hazelburn, the triple-distilled malt from Springbank was distilled 2004. Aged for 13 years in a mixture of first-fill and refill oloroso-sherry casks, this is sweet and creamy with notes of strawberries and cream, Turkish Delight, marzipan and walnuts.

Limited to just 9,000 bottles worldwide this 13 year old Campbeltown single malt is a limited edition from Springbank, the region’s oldest operational distillery. Unpeated and triple-distilled, this expression has been matured in Oloroso sherry casks and bottled at 47.4% abv.
Hazelburn 13 Year Old Sherry Wood Campbeltown Single Malt Scotch Whisky Tasting Notes
Nose: Rich dark chocolate and rose petals with ginger biscuits and freshly brewed espresso.
Palate: Fresh cream and strawberries with Turkish Delight, clotted cream, marzipan, strawberry jam and walnuts.
Finish: Sticky toffee pudding and coffee liqueur with some fruity notes and a touch of black pepper.
Distillery Information
Hazelburn Distillery was a distillery in Campbeltown, Scotland, which was in operation between approximately 1825 and 1925. In 1886, it had 22 employees and produced 192,000 gallons of whisky per year, making it the largest distillery in the town. The distillery was bought by Mitchell & Co. in 1920, but shut down in 1926. Mitchell & Co. owned two other distilleries, including Springbank Distillery. Since 2005 Springbank Distillery bottles a whisky called Hazelburn Single Malt.
